What if the way you speak to your partner became the safest place in your relationship — not a source of stress?

If you’ve ever thought, “We talk, but it doesn’t feel like we’re hearing each other,” or noticed how one small comment can spiral into silence or tension — you’re not alone.

This compassionate guide offers a new way forward: one honest, heartfelt conversation at a time.

Let’s bust a few myths:

  • “If we love each other, communication should be easy.”
    Truth: Even the most loving couples have blind spots. Communication is a skill.
  • “Good communication means never arguing.”
    Truth: Conflict isn’t the enemy — avoidance is. Disagreements can bring you closer.
  • “We’re not in crisis, so we don’t need this.”
    Truth: Healthy communication deepens connection, even when things are okay.

Inside, you’ll learn to:

  • Create emotional safety so both partners feel seen and secure.
  • Express needs and boundaries clearly — without guilt or fear.
  • Handle tension and triggers with empathy and self-awareness.
  • Build trust through presence, kindness, and emotional intelligence.

Whether you’ve been together two years or twenty, this evidence-based, heart-led audiobook meets you where you are — with gentle reflection prompts, real stories, and tools you can use right away.
